A particle's dynamics are considered "relativistic" when its velocity is a significant fraction of the speed of light.  For example, the mass of a moving particle seen by a stationary observer increases in proportion to the square root of 1/(1 - (v/c)2).  For typical speeds in the everyday world it is not noticeable, but take a fast moving fundamental particle and you may have apparent mass increases or changes in its lifetime as a consequence of time dilation.   Look at this factor for the electron you measured at 100 V in the glass globe. Pick the best answer.     The effect is less than 0.1 %.     The effect is around 1%.     The effect is around 10%.     The effect is a factor of 2 change in mass
